(2010-02-22 22:08:55 UTC)Whew - no wonder it's the fastest selling $7 CdR around. $13 alc. A 3/4 ruby in the glass. Upon opening there is a gamey, smokiness to this. Let it sit and swirl and it really opens up. Blueberry, dark currant, cassis, spice, chocolate, a fundamental earthiness and herbs on the nose. On the palate there is a french toast note with mushroom, white pepper, dark cherry and blueberry. The tannins are gripping and the acidity brilliant. The earthiness and mushrooms are pulled to the end and the white pepper and acidity really give the end a pop. This needs lamb and hearty beef dishes. Very well done and will fill out some, drink through 2012. Paul

(2009-11-16 17:31:53 UTC)The color is a rich ruby red, brilliant and clear. Surprisingly even from end to end, as well.
On the nose are some very rich ripe red cherry notes. Not the sour cherry I’ve noticed lately in some of the Spanish wines I’ve had, but very ripe. Sharp notes of granny smith apples and a softness of grass are also there. All in all, extremely inviting.
The wine is dry, with a fairly light body but a long finish that lingers (very much a good thing). Notes of red fruit, plums, and pomegranate abound and dance around. There is a clean fruit-forwardness to the wine that is in no way like the big, bold, over-the-top California wines. Much more refined, tighter, but still with plenty of fruit for people who love that in their wine.
